Xeikon will be demonstrating four different automated production lines at the Labelexpo 2019. Exhibiting in three dedicated areas on Stand 28, Hall 5C, Xeikon will present its wide-web, large format labels for the chemical and automotive industries, its latest durable labels for the health & beauty and food & wine sectors, and its dry toner and laminating technologies for flexible packaging and pouches.

The company will also demonstrate its Label Discovery Package for entry-level investments. Across the show, Xeikon will participate in the Sustainability Insight Café and the Flexible Packaging Arena.

Sustainability Insight café

At their Information Booth in the Sustainability Zone, Xeikon will share its own initiatives taken throughout the years to address and inspire others. Additionally, the company will demonstrate different label and packaging applications that offer sustainable and economically feasible alternatives to commonly used products. Offering paper cup converters potential new business opportunities, Xeikon will demonstrate the next generation of sustainable food packaging safely printed with Xeikon’s dry toner digital technology working with Kotkamills ISLA Duoboard paper cup stock. They will also present their UV dry toner technology, an FDA certified digital label printing solution ideal for labels that have direct or indirect contact with food. The company will also discuss its own methodology at its toner plant in Belgium, where natural gas and heat consumption has been reduced, reducing, in turn, CO2 emissions.

Flexible Packaging Arena

In this arena, Xeikon will showcase its dry toner technology and its innovative solutions for flexible packaging and pouch production with complete food safety compliance. Xeikon will demonstrate its CX500 press combined with an offline laminator, and show the full production process of creating a flexible packaging laminate using digital print.
